Why 1MW Energy Storage Container Size Matters
The physical dimensions of a 1MW energy storage container directly impact deployment flexibility and operational efficiency. Imagine trying to fit a puzzle piece into a crowded board – the right container size ensures seamless integration with existing infrastructure while maximizing energy density.
Typical Dimensions for 1MW Systems
- Standard ISO Container: 20-40 feet in length (6-12 meters)
- Height: 8-9.5 feet (2.4-2.9 meters)
- Weight: 15-25 metric tons when fully equipped

Key Factors Influencing Container Design
When we talk about 1MW energy storage container size, three critical elements dominate the conversation:
1. Battery Technology Selection
Lithium-ion batteries typically require 30-40% less space than lead-acid alternatives. For instance, EK SOLAR's latest NMC battery configuration achieves 1MW capacity in just 22 sq.m – comparable to a single-car garage space.
2. Thermal Management Needs
- Air-cooled systems add 10-15% to container volume
- Liquid cooling solutions reduce footprint by 8% but increase complexity
3. Regional Compliance Standards
Did you know? EU regulations mandate 20% more safety clearance space compared to Asian markets, directly affecting container dimensions.

FAQs: 1MW Energy Storage Container Size
- Q: Can containers be customized for height restrictions? A: Yes, low-profile designs (under 8ft) are available for regions with strict zoning laws.
- Q: How does container size affect installation costs? A: Every 10% reduction in footprint typically lowers site preparation costs by 15-18%.
